Expert Tips for Air Tent Success

  • Don’t Over-Inflate: Use the pressure gauge on the pump. You want it firm, not about to pop like a balloon at a kid’s birthday party.
  • Ground Sheet is Vital: Even though the floor is tough, always use a footprint to protect the air beams from sharp rocks.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Is it really waterproof?
A: Yes! It features high-grade waterproof coating and taped seams to keep you dry in 4-season weather.

Q: What happens if it gets a hole?
A: It comes with a repair kit, but the TPU air beams are encased in heavy-duty sleeves, making punctures very rare.

Q: Can I use it in the winter?
A: Absolutely. It’s a 4-season tent with great insulation properties compared to thin nylon tents.
